Drivetrain
The GWM Tank 500 uses a Hybrid producing 255kW and 648Nm of torque, sent through a 9-speed auto to a 4WD layout. It covers the 0-100km/h sprint in 8.5 seconds.
The Subaru Uncharted responds with a Dual Electric Motor making 252kW, paired to a automatic driving all four wheels. It gets to 100km/h in 5 seconds.

Space & Comfort
The GWM Tank 500 measures 5,078mm long on a 2,850mm wheelbase, 543mm longer than the Subaru Uncharted at 4,535mm (2,750mm wheelbase). The longer wheelbase on the GWM Tank 500 generally means more rear legroom.
